There has been considerable debate about nurse staffing levels, with the Telegraph story from the weekend drawing together CQC assessments that 17 acute trusts are dangerously under-staffed.

The imminent arrival of the Francis Report will return the issue to salience.

The Health Select Committee's new report on the Care Quality Commission pulls fewer punches than an un-bribed boxer, stating that even though "the CQC has developed a much keener focus on patient safety and has a better appreciation of what it exists to do (not much of an achievement) ... we remain to be convinced that the CQC has successfully defined its core purpose.
